Hopf bifurcations of twisted states in phase oscillators rings with nonpairwise higher-order interactions
Synchronization is an essential collective phenomenon in networks of interacting oscillators. Twisted states are rotating wave solutions in ring networks where the oscillator phases wrap around the circle in a linear fashion.
